50a0f4c2504d6a43fb8ccfc7c33747aa3b71e276bc425aa6c3645c2959dc8762

1300815 (377317 blocks ago)

⏴ Block 1300814 (84b529c7...529) | Block 1300816 ⏵ | Latest block ⏭

Metadata

16/4/23, 8:32 am UTC (524d 1:15:03 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details